Sec. 11. (a) Information entered into the web based claims reimbursement and sexual assault examination kit tracking system for the purposes of reimbursement to a provider for a forensic medical exam or the location of a sexual assault examination kit is confidential until the later of the following:
(1) The sexual assault examination kit is destroyed in accordance with section 10 of this chapter.
(2) The conclusion of a case filed by a prosecuting attorney with appropriate jurisdiction.
(b) A victim's:
(1) personal information; and
(2) medical records;
are confidential.
